Obituaries Related to "Olsen" from New York Times Archive


Keith Olsen, Rock Hitmaker With a Broad Résumé, Dies at 74

2020-03-12T18:27:44+0000

He worked on albums by the Grateful Dead, Santana, Pat Benatar and Whitesnake. He also brought Stevie Nicks and Lindsey Buckingham to Fleetwood Mac.


Dorothy Olsen, a Pioneering Pilot in World War II, Dies at 103

2019-08-09T15:51:54+0000

She was one of 38 surviving members of the WASPs, who freed men for combat duty by ferrying military planes to domestic embarkation points.


Clark B. Olsen, Witness to a Civil Rights Killing, Dies at 85

2019-01-28T21:37:47+0000

In Selma, Ala., in 1965, he saw a fellow minister, James Reeb, take a fatal blow to the head, a murder with national consequences.


Jack Larson, a TV Jimmy Olsen Turned Playwright, Dies at 87

2015-09-21T04:11:55+0000

Mr. Larson, who went on to write plays and librettos, predicted that he would be best remembered as the eager cub reporter for The Daily Planet on ‘Superman.’


Ken Olsen, Who Built DEC Into a Power, Dies at 84

2011-02-08T02:14:09+0000

Mr. Olsen helped reshape the computer industry as a founder of the Digital Equipment Corporation, at one time the world’s second-largest computer company.


Merlin Olsen, Football Star, Commentator and Actor, Dies at 69

2010-03-11T17:29:41+0000

Mr. Olsen was a Hall of Fame tackle who anchored the Los Angeles Rams’ Fearsome Foursome, the line that glamorized defensive play in the N.F.L.

Paid Notice: Deaths OLSEN, THEODORE JAMES

2006-02-21T05:00:00+0000

OLSEN--Theodore James. Died February 15. Born on September 8, 1929, in Manchester, IN, to Howard and Dorothy (Scull) Olsen. Graduated with distinction from Indiana University in 1951 and with MBA in 1954. Corporate VP at Olin Corp and Pitney Bowes, member of Executive Committee at Touche Ross, and VP of the National Executive Service Corps.
